**Challenges Abound: Technical Hurdles and Adaptation Needs**
The primary challenge lies in the fundamental differences between the desktop and mobile environments. Here's a breakdown of the key obstacles:
* **Control Scheme Adaptation:** This is perhaps the most significant hurdle. RPG Maker MV games often rely on complex keyboard mappings for movement, combat, and menu navigation. Translating these inputs to a touch-screen interface requires thoughtful design. Virtual joysticks, on-screen buttons, and gesture-based controls are potential solutions, but each comes with its own set of advantages and disadvantages. The key is to find a control scheme that feels intuitive and responsive, allowing players to seamlessly navigate the game world.
* **Performance Optimization:** Mobile devices have limited processing power compared to desktop computers. Running RPG Maker MV games, which can be resource-intensive, requires significant optimization. This involves streamlining code, reducing texture sizes, and employing techniques like sprite sheet packing and object pooling to minimize memory usage and improve performance.
* **UI/UX Considerations:** The user interface (UI) and user experience (UX) must be carefully adapted for smaller screens. Text needs to be legible, buttons need to be large enough to tap accurately, and menus need to be organized in a way that is easy to navigate on a touch screen. The entire UI needs to be redesigned with mobile usability in mind.
* **Cross-Platform Compatibility:** Ensuring seamless compatibility across different iOS devices, with varying screen sizes and resolutions, is crucial. The game must scale gracefully and maintain its visual fidelity on everything from iPhones to iPads.
* **Input Method Handling:** Integrating with iOS input methods such as the on-screen keyboard for text input during dialogues or name entry is crucial.
* **Save Data Management:** Handling save data across different devices presents a challenge. Cloud-based save solutions could provide a seamless experience, allowing players to continue their progress on different iOS devices.
* **Plugin Compatibility:** A significant strength of RPG Maker MV is its extensive plugin ecosystem. Ensuring compatibility with popular plugins on iOS is essential to preserve the flexibility and customization options that developers have come to rely on.

**Monetization Strategies: Finding the Right Balance**
Choosing the right monetization strategy is crucial for the success of any mobile game. Several options are available to RPG Maker MV developers:
* **Premium Pricing:** A one-time purchase price provides a clean and straightforward experience for players.
* **Free-to-Play with IAPs (In-App Purchases):** This model allows players to download and play the game for free, with the option to purchase items or content to enhance their experience.
* **Subscription Model:** A recurring subscription fee grants access to the game and potentially additional content or features.
The ideal monetization strategy will depend on the specific game and its target audience. It's important to strike a balance between generating revenue and providing a fair and enjoyable experience for players.
